The House Agricultural Affairs Committee approved temporary rules clarifying CWD testing procedures and aligning rule language with House Bill 591 after the department confirmed two domestic CWD cases in eastern Idaho.

The House Agricultural Affairs Committee approved a temporary rule package (docket 0204192401) that clarifies chronic wasting disease (CWD) testing procedures, defines "animal health emergency" in rule, and implements consistency with House Bill 591.
